The Scottish Government-owned Caledonian Sleeper is the only overnight rail journey between Scotland and London. With a rich history dating back over 150 years, the service provides a practical, stress-free way for business and leisure travellers to arrive fresh, relaxed, and breakfasted in the heart of their destination in time for a full day of meetings or sightseeing.
Before partnering with Node4, Caledonian Sleeper relied on a legacy telephony system, an outdated CRM platform, and a standalone live chat application. A lack of integration between these systems affected the organisation’s ability to deliver a consistently high standard of customer service, which is expected of this unique service. It also hampered the collection of detailed customer-centric data.
“Caledonian Sleeper’s legacy managed CRM solution and telephony platform meant we had limited access to customer information, sales data and call centre management stats,” Mark Lonie, Guest Service Centre Manager at Caledonian Sleeper, explains. “To complicate matters, our customer service team also relied on approaching end-of-life versions of software and a customer-facing live chat platform. Neither of which could integrate with the managed CRM solution or telephony platform.”
Taking back control of customer relationship management
“Node4 had secured Microsoft funding to assess and review our CRM environment,” Mark recalls. “But the project became a much higher priority when we were tasked with bringing the managed components back in-house. At that point, we resumed our discussions with Node4. We commissioned a project to create a seamless solution that replaced our third-party CRM system with the Microsoft Dynamics 365 Customer Relationship Management platform. This upgrade also included an omnichannel contact centre and an improved live chat application.”
The transition to a unified system was completed in record time, allowing Caledonian Sleeper to move away from its managed customer service infrastructure without disruption or additional costs. Mark shares: “The project was complex, yet Node4 delivered it in just a couple of months – around a third of the time that’s usually required. Node4’s flexibility and collaborative approach made this possible, allowing us to meet the Scottish Government’s strict timeline.”
Instant access to customer data across the entire CRM system
The new omnichannel call centre, Microsoft CRM platform and live chat all integrate seamlessly, giving agents a 360-degree view of each customer. “It’s a million miles away from the disparate systems we used to rely on. These days, when a call comes in, the customer’s information is automatically gathered from across the system and loaded onto the agent’s screen – giving them vital contextualising data that helps with faster call resolution and customer satisfaction,” Mark notes.
Detailed analysis and reporting capabilities
Caledonian Sleeper’s fully integrated and unified CRM solution enables contact centre managers to check call performance and run call analysis. This drives efficiency and promotes a consistently high standard of customer interactions. It also allows Mark and his team to conduct detailed analysis of common passenger pain points. “We can cross-reference that data and see how and where these kinds of issues impact customer service. Detailed insights like these directly enhance our ability to deliver continuous improvement by providing actionable intelligence and ensuring issues are fixed,” Mark comments.
Direct access to customer data
“Having direct control over our telephony infrastructure has also allowed us to implement simple changes that significantly improve customer experience. For example, we can update the recorded messages that customers hear when they call our contact centre. So, if there’s bad weather and a delay occurs, we can acknowledge this and offer advice and information – potentially resolving customer queries without speaking to an agent. This has huge implications for call centre efficiency and managing potential spikes in phone calls,” Mark explains.
Rolling out AI in a contact centre environment
Microsoft’s CRM platform features Copilot integration. It offers a pathway for Mark and his team to take advantage of AI and machine learning in a controlled and measured way that improves the quality and speed of agent response – enhancing, rather than replacing, vital human interactions.
“Our agents have the option of Copilot support when they’re writing to customers, helping them draft quick and accurate written responses,” Mark comments. “We also use Copilot to summarise interactions and produce call notes, which speeds up the case creation process – allowing agents to focus on customer interactions rather than admin.”
